Hot damn, Andreas, this is great! You commented on my snare sound, but I quite like yours, too!

I notice a few potential opportunities for improvement: the lead vocal intro, while breathtaking (literally, my heart skipped a beat more than once Smile ) is a bit too loud. The high vocal level is making it hard for you to really blow up during the choruses, which don't have quite enough power compared to the verses. The verses at times had my eyes watering at the sweetness and tender delivery, but the verses connected with me more emotionally than the choruses, so I think you should give that a look.

There's also some pretty severe and audible compression on the lead vocal in a few places throughout the mix. You're very in control, and that's a good thing, but you'll get more power out of a more dynamic vocal. I suggest a soft knee design for more transparency and a lower ratio... there's also maybe a bit too much in the low end, you don't need as much in pop, and this will also improve the way your compressor reacts to the level. It sounds like you may have dipped the high frequency values of the vocals, but it's possible that the low mids are masking it a bit. As I recall the vocal track has a lot of lovely air around 8000, and that'll give you enough "cut" so you won't need as much compression. My personal strategy was to use tape saturation to level the vocals out a bit less distractingly, and to use a simple compressor to catch any errant peaks.

The guitar solo could use a good deal more low end, but that track's contributions sound perfect elsewhere. Simple automation fix: ease up on the low shelving/highpass bandwidth!
